§712-1276 Costs and expenses.
For any attorneys' fees, costs, or expenses incurred in the closing of the
building, premises, or place and keeping it closed, or incurred in enforcing
the injunction prohibiting the person or persons causing, maintaining, aiding,
abetting, or permitting the nuisance from residing or entering into the
building, premises, or place in or upon which the nuisance exists, as well as
the attorneys' fees, costs, and expenses incurred by the party bringing the
action, a reasonable sum shall be allowed by the court. [L 1979, c 181, pt of
§2; am L 1996, c 246, §7; am L 2004, c 44, §27; am L 2005, c 123, §7]
